About Codemao

Codemao (编程猫) is a Shenzhen, China-based children's coding education platform — backed with $360+ million in total funding at a $7.3 billion valuation as of 2024 — providing 31+ million students aged 4-16 with visual programming and AI literacy education through proprietary tools including Kitten (a Scratch-inspired visual programming language optimized for mobile) and Nemo (mobile coding application). The platform partners with 11,500 schools across China and generates approximately $17 million in annual revenue. In 2025, TIME magazine ranked Codemao as the top EdTech company globally, and UNESCO launched a partnership with Codemao on the Africa-Asia Youth Coding Initiative Phase 2 (2025-2030) to expand digital skills education across developing nations. Founded in December 2014 in Paris by Sun Yue and Li Tianchi (Chinese graduate students at EIT Digital Master School), operating from Shenzhen headquarters with offices in Beijing and Shanghai and 3,000+ employees.

Business Model & Competitive Advantage

Codemao's visual programming education model addresses the coding education accessibility gap in China's K-12 system: traditional computer science education uses text-based programming languages that create a steep learning curve for children under 12 — with the syntax, debugging, and abstract thinking requirements exceeding the cognitive development stage of young learners. Codemao's Kitten visual programming language (using drag-and-drop code blocks that snap together like puzzle pieces, with immediate visual feedback as children create games and animations) provides the intrinsic motivation loop that sustains coding practice: children build a platformer game in the first session, creating the engagement that drives continued learning. The mobile-first design (80% of Chinese children access Codemao on smartphones and tablets, not desktop computers) and cartoon character integration (characters familiar from Chinese children's media) create platform stickiness through the "children play, parents pay" monetization model.

Competitive Landscape 2025–2026

In 2025, Codemao competes in the China children's coding education, K-12 STEM programming, and global coding EdTech market with Scratch (MIT Media Lab, free open-source platform), Code.org (US non-profit, global K-12 coding curriculum), and Roblox (NYSE: RBLX, game creation platform with coding elements) for Chinese K-12 coding education curriculum adoption and global developing-market coding literacy programs. The UNESCO Africa-Asia Youth Coding Initiative partnership (Phase 2 covering 2025-2030 across Africa and Asia) expands Codemao's mission beyond China into the global EdTech market where demand for digital skills education is highest in emerging markets. The $7.3 billion valuation (achieved through aggressive school partnership and consumer app growth in China's competitive K-12 supplemental education market) reflects the platform's dominant position. The 2025 strategy focuses on growing the AI literacy curriculum (introducing LLM concepts and prompt engineering in the Kitten visual environment), expanding the UNESCO partnership countries, and building the competitive programming tournament ecosystem that drives platform engagement among older students.

Li Tianchi

CEO & Co-Founder

Li Tianchi co-founded Codemao after studying at EIT Digital Master School in Paris. Named to MIT Technology Review's Innovators Under 35, he leads Codemao's mission to make coding accessible to every child. His vision of teaching students through play has reached 31 million children.

Sun Yue

Co-Founder

Sun Yue met Li Tianchi at the EIT Digital Master School while studying Human Interaction Design. Together they founded Codemao after witnessing young European children's coding proficiency at the 2014 Web Summit. He focuses on product development and user experience.
